Waiver Default definition

Waiver Default means the occurrence of any Default or Unmatured Default other than a Waived Default.
Waiver Default means (i) the occurrence of any Default or Event of Default; (ii) the failure of any Credit Party to comply timely with any term, condition, or covenant set forth in the Ninth Amendment, the Tenth Amendment, the Eleventh Amendment, the Twelfth Amendment, the Thirteenth Amendment, the Fourteenth Amendment, or this Fifteenth Amendment; or (iii) the failure of any representation or warranty made by any Credit Party under Section 6 of the Ninth Amendment, the Tenth Amendment, the Eleventh Amendment, the Twelfth Amendment, the Thirteenth Amendment, the Fourteenth Amendment or this Fifteenth Amendment to be true and complete in all material respects (or, to the extent any such representation or warranty is qualified by materiality or Material Adverse Change, in any respect) as of the date when made.
Waiver Default means (i) the occurrence of any Default or Event of Default; (ii) the failure of any Credit Party to comply timely with any term, condition, or covenant set forth in the Ninth Amendment, the Tenth Amendment, the Eleventh Amendment, or this Twelfth Amendment; or (iii) the failure of any representation or warranty made by any Credit Party under Section 6 of the Ninth Amendment, the Tenth Amendment, the Eleventh Amendment or this Twelfth Amendment to be true and complete in all material respects (or, to the extent any such representation or warranty is qualified by materiality or Material Adverse Change, in any respect) as of the date when made.
